Cecile
(Kingston, Jamaica) - Dancehall Diva Ce’Cile has a vibrant new tune out! While Ce’Cile has often been recognized for racy lyrics; this time she’s delivered a clean powerful provoking song on an old school Riddim. Musicians turned producers/artists Leftside & Esco laid down the newly made – Throwback Giggy Riddim off their Young Legends label distributed through VP Records. Ce'Cile's new song is appropriately titled "Hot like Dat".

Mr. Easy
(Kingston, Jamaica) - Dancehall singer Mr. Easy has carefully continued to record with top notch producers delivering unparallel songs about relationships, reality and also representing the island’s laid back ultra smooth rudebwoys. His song "Falling" from producer Don Corleon’s Seasons Riddim has experienced wide airplay across Jamaica since summer. The song has also found its way into the mix at mainstream radio, primarily on the East Coast; during a set that fuses TOK’s hit "Footprints" with other strong one drop releases.

World Clash 2005
Irish and Chin’s World Clash series of events traveled to Jamaica, Antigua and Canada this year. Now, the flagship event is returning to Brooklyn, New York, where the monumental World Clash 1999 set new standards for the sound clash industry.

The phenomenal World Clash is slated to take place at Brooklyn’s hot spot, Elite Ark on October 8, 2005 during Columbus Day Weekend. This stellar competition, which currently boasts the likes of Bass Odyssey, Mighty Crown and Black Kat as competing sounds, will entertain fans in the nation’s hub of Dancehall music and Caribbean culture, Brooklyn, New York. The event will be hosted by Noah, one of Brooklyn’s popular selectors.

Chico
(Kingston, Jamaica) Dancehall singer Chico has made a French Connection! Chico recorded the song "Hey Sexy Wow" with Universal France’s recording artist Lord Kossity. Lord Kossity, an artist whose style is a combination of Hip Hop and Dancehall, sought out Chico when recording his latest album "Booming System" released June 2005. "Hey Sexy Wow" is the first single off this new album.

Dutch Reggae Star "Ziggi"
Dutch Born, (March 8th 1981) R.Blijden a.k.a Ziggi is one of Rock'n'Vibes (Dutch Label) most versatile dancehall/reggae artistes. He left the Netherlands at an early age, destination: St. Eustatius (The Caribbean). While living there he was introduced to a wide variety music genres such as gospel, rap, hip-hop, reggae and dancehall, which formed the basis of the artist he is today.
